According to Stratistics MRC, the Global Lentil Protein Market is accounted for $223.08 million in 2024 and is expected to reach $336.6 million by 2030 growing at a CAGR of 7.1% during the forecast period. Lentil protein is a plant-based protein derived from lentils, a type of legume known for its high nutritional value. It is extracted through processes like milling and protein isolation, resulting in a concentrated protein powder or ingredient used in food products. Rich in essential amino acids, fiber, and minerals, lentil protein is a sustainable and allergen-friendly alternative to animal proteins. It is commonly used in plant-based foods, protein supplements, and meat alternatives due to its high digestibility and functional properties. Lentil protein supports muscle growth, satiety, and overall health while being a key component in vegetarian and vegan diets.

High Processing Costs
High processing costs pose a significant hurdle to the market, restricting its growth potential. These high expenses are a result of the intricate and energy-intensive extraction procedures as well as the requirement for sophisticated machinery. As a result, lentil protein products become less competitive when compared to other plant-based proteins due to their increased overall cost. Demand and adoption are hampered as a result, particularly in sectors where prices are crucial.

Supply Chain and Raw Material Availability
Supply chain interruptions and raw material availability difficulties have a substantial impact on the lentil protein market. Production is hampered and expenses are raised by shortages of lentil supply brought on by erratic weather, difficult farming, and logistical delays. As a result, there is less lentil protein available, which makes it harder for producers to satisfy consumer demand. Product costs increase as a result, and the development of items made from lentils may stall, which would hinder market expansion as a whole.
